WebThinker is a reasoning agent designed to autonomously search, deeply explore web pages, and draft research reports, all within its thinking process. Moving away from traditional agents that follow a predefined workflow, WebThinker enables the large reasoning model itself to perform actions on its own during thinking, achieving end-to-end task execution in a single generation.
